7 Warning Signs of Scams When Buying a Hasselblad X2D II on Cdiscount

1. Unrealistically Low 'Flash Sale' Prices

Be extremely wary of 'flash sales' or listings offering the Hasselblad X2D II at prices significantly below market value. For example, prices advertised at under $2000 for an $8000+ camera are a clear indicator of a scam. Scammers often use these unbelievable deals to lure unsuspecting buyers.

Safety Warning

If a deal seems too good to be true, it almost certainly is. Always compare prices with reputable retailers and trusted second-hand markets.

2. Counterfeit Luxury Appliance (Camera)

Scammers may attempt to sell counterfeit versions of high-value items like the Hasselblad X2D II. These fakes may have subtle differences in branding, materials, or missing markings such as 'HANDMADE IN SWEDEN'. Always scrutinize product images and descriptions for any discrepancies.

3. The 'Order Problem' SMS Phish

Be cautious of unsolicited SMS messages claiming there's an 'order problem' with your Hasselblad X2D II purchase on Cdiscount. These messages often contain malicious links designed to steal your personal information or financial details.

4. Off-Platform Bank Transfer Lure

Scammers may try to convince you to complete the transaction outside of Cdiscount's platform, often by requesting payment via bank transfer or other unsecured methods. This bypasses buyer protection and leaves you vulnerable. Always keep transactions within the official Cdiscount payment system.

5. Fake Websites Mimicking Official Retailers

Be aware of fake websites that closely mimic the official Hasselblad or Cdiscount sites, often with URLs that are slightly altered (e.g., .za.com instead of .com). These sites offer fraudulent deals and aim to steal your payment information.

6. Sophisticated Delivery Scams

Some scams involve manipulated tracking numbers or misleading delivery notifications. For instance, a UPS tracking number might show delivery to your zip code but not your specific address, or a seller might claim an item was shipped when it was not. Always verify tracking information through official carrier websites and be skeptical of unusual delivery claims.

7. Inauthentic Product Details and Seller History

Scammers often use generic or stolen images and may have brand new accounts with little to no seller history. If a seller has very few or no positive reviews, or provides vague or inconsistent details about the Hasselblad X2D II, it's a significant red flag.
